Set during a house party at the eccentric Stover family home, this comedy of manners explores the clash between traditional ideals and contemporary realities. George Bernard Shaw, known for his critiques of social issues, delves into themes such as class privilege and the exploitation of the working class. Through sharp wit and engaging dialogue, the narrative examines the complexities of relationships and societal norms in early 20th-century England.
